Wallpaper Materials Guide

Three materials, and how to choose between them for your wall.

Materials

Every design is available in three materials. All three are Class A fire rated and Prop 65 compliant. They look and install differently, so choose based on your wall and your situation. Swatches are shown at 2× zoom — tap any swatch to enlarge it.

Close-up swatch of Vinyl Peel and Stick wallpaper showing a smooth surface with a slightly satin sheenTap to enlarge

Vinyl Peel & Stick

  • Smooth surface with a slightly satin sheen
  • Durable and easy to clean
  • High-tack removable adhesive — the stronger grip of the two peel and stick materials
  • Will adhere to moderately textured walls
  • The E-Z Hang Peel & Stick Helper is highly recommended
Class A fire ratedProp 65 compliant
Close-up swatch of Premium Fabric Peel and Stick wallpaper showing a matte finish over a fine micro-weave textureTap to enlarge

Fabric Peel & Stick

  • Matte finish over a very fine micro-weave
  • Durable and easy to clean
  • The easiest of the three to install
  • Can indirectly support LEED v4 credits through its material composition and environmental profile
  • The renter-friendly choice — removes without damaging paint
Class A fire ratedProp 65 compliant
Close-up swatch of Unpasted Traditional wallpaper showing a canvas sand textureTap to enlarge

Unpasted Traditional

  • Type II 20oz textured non-adhesive wallpaper, non-woven backing
  • Best for slightly textured walls
  • Hung with heavy-weight wallpaper paste — paste is not included
  • Widely used in commercial settings
  • How well it holds, and how easily it comes off later, depends on the paste your installer uses
Class A fire ratedProp 65 compliant

Before you order, check two things.

1. Your paint. Peel and stick wallpaper — fabric or vinyl — is not compatible with Sherwin Williams ProMar 400 Zero VOC paints, or any paint marketed as Stain-Resistant, Anti-Stain, or Anti-microbial, unless you first prime the wall with Roman Pro-935 R-35 Primer.

2. How recently you painted. If the wall has been painted recently, wait 30 days before installing. Fresh paint needs to fully cure and finish outgassing — installing sooner risks adhesion problems.

Around 99% of peel-and-stick failures come down to wall texture or paint incompatibility, and because everything is made to order we can't accept returns for wall incompatibility. If you're unsure, send us a photo first.

Common questions
What's the difference in finish between vinyl and fabric?
Fabric Peel & Stick is matte, over a very fine micro-weave. Vinyl Peel & Stick is smooth, with a slightly satin sheen. Both are durable and easy to clean.
Which material should I choose if I'm renting?
Fabric Peel & Stick. It removes without damaging paint, so you can put the wall back as you found it.
Which peel and stick material has the stronger adhesive?
Vinyl Peel & Stick — it has the higher tack of the two peel and stick materials. We recommend using it with the E-Z Hang Peel & Stick Helper. Unpasted Traditional isn't part of that comparison: it has no adhesive of its own, so how firmly it holds depends entirely on the paste your installer uses.
Will it work on a textured wall?
Unpasted Traditional suits slightly textured walls. For peel and stick, the more texture a wall has, the less surface area the adhesive can grip. While our vinyl peel and stick will adhere to moderately textured walls, heavily textured or bumpy walls may need skim-coating first. If you're unsure about your wall, send us a photo through chat or email [email protected] and we'll check before you order.
Which paints are not compatible?
Sherwin Williams ProMar 400 Zero VOC, and any paint marketed as Stain-Resistant, Anti-Stain or Anti-microbial. You can still use these walls if you first prime with Roman Pro-935 R-35 Primer.
I just painted — how long should I wait before installing?
Wait 30 days. Fresh paint needs to fully cure and finish outgassing before wallpaper goes on. Installing sooner is one of the most common causes of adhesion failure.
Are these fire rated? Are they Prop 65 compliant?
Yes to both. All three materials are Class A fire rated and Prop 65 compliant. Fabric Peel & Stick can also indirectly support LEED v4 credits through its material composition and environmental profile.
Can I use wallpaper in a bathroom or kitchen?
Yes. All three materials handle bathroom and kitchen humidity, and all are water resistant — they can be wiped down with water and a damp cloth. Test any chemical cleaner in an inconspicuous spot first.
Is wallpaper paste included with unpasted wallpaper?
No. Unpasted Traditional needs heavy-weight wallpaper paste, supplied separately.

A soft gradient that shifts gently from top to bottom — calming rather than decorative, and one of the easiest ways to give a nursery or bedroom a finished, considered look without pattern.

This is a mural with a 4-roll repeat. The pattern is 96 inches wide, running across four panels before repeating, so each roll is a specific panel in the sequence — rolls are not interchangeable and a generic "spare roll" does not apply. Order the exact panels you need.

Mural patterns do not repeat vertically, so each roll length has its own unique artwork.

The mural design will not match between sizes — please order one size only.
